foreword

英 [ˈfɔːwɜːd]

美 [ˈfɔːrwɜːrd]

n.  (书的)前言,序言

复数:forewords 

GRETEM8

BNC.15723 / COCA.20134

牛津词典

    noun

    • (书的)前言,序言
      a short introduction at the beginning of a book

      柯林斯词典

      • (书的)前言,序言
        Theforewordto a book is an introduction by the author or by someone else.
